Family Paws

Tuesday, March 28, 2023

Join us for an evening of learning where our Family Paws Parent Educator will provide expecting families with practical education and support during pregnancy to increase safety and decrease concerns many new parents and families may have about the family dog. Our emphasis is on a positive, practical and preventive approach to challenges that arise with a new little one in the household. Here are some highlights: - Dogs & Storks™ is an international program created by Family Paws Parent Education that helps expecting families with dogs prepare for life with baby. - Dogs & Toddlers™ emphasizes the importance of including family dogs in a safe and comfortable manner for all. - We discuss specific ways to include family dogs in daily baby routines from the start! - We educate about different types of supervision and offer solutions for safety. - Our program addresses the changing family dynamics and how that may impact the family dog.

DAWNITA GILLMAN, CPDT-KSA , FPPE Educator Dawnita has been involved with the Cochrane & Area Humane Society for over 14 years and considers the ability to be able to work with people and their pets a privilege. She is a Certified Professional Dog Trainer – Knowledge & Skills Assessed (CPDT-KSA) through the Certification Council for Professional Dog Trainers, holds a professional membership with the Association of Professional Dog Trainers (APDT) and is a licensed Family Paws™ Parent Education Educator. As well as her love for animals, Dawnita has a zeal for further education in the areas of animal behaviour and rehabilitation, coaching and training, building respectful relationships between animals and the people that interact with them, assisting in ways to help shelter pets be placed in loving homes and in keeping pets in their existing homes through professional support and guidance. Her goal is to focus on strengthening the human-dog relationship through positive reinforcement, reward based training, clear communication & better understanding of the companion dog.
